The Sales Enablement Manager role is a vital to designing, developing, and delivering impactful enablement programs focused on onboarding, new sales, customer engagement, retention, and expansion. This role is pivotal in equipping the commercial team with the tools, resources, and training necessary to enhance their effectiveness, shorten ramp time, and consistently achieve or surpass company goals.
Your Responsibilities To The Team, Our Clients And Community
Commercial Team Training & Coaching
- Develop and execute a comprehensive enablement strategy that equips sales, operations, product, and marketing teams with the necessary tools, content, and training to drive revenue growth. Deliver engaging training through live workshops, virtual sessions, and on-demand resources
- Design and implement robust onboarding and ongoing training programs that enhance market, industry, and product knowledge while improving sales effectiveness and ensuring consistent positioning and messaging
- Collaborate closely with the marketing and product teams to ensure that sales materials and messaging are perfectly aligned with Navigate’s mission and value proposition
- Establish standardized practices for consultative selling, account-based selling, and competitive positioning to empower sales teams with proven strategies
- Offer actionable insights and feedback to refine prospect and client interactions, helping sales representatives and account managers convert opportunities and build stronger client relationships
- Track the success of enablement initiatives by monitoring key metrics such as training completion rates, ramp-up times, and improvements in client engagement
- Maintain a well-organized repository of all enablement content, including playbooks, training materials, product guides, marketing resources, and presentations, ensuring materials are current, accessible, and relevant
- Collaborate with marketing to develop various sales materials like presentations, demos, case studies, and one-pagers tailored to different sales stages and customer segments
- Train and support sales and operations team members to customize content delivery based on customer needs and situations
- Provide ongoing training to the commercial team on how to effectively utilize the available content and incorporate into their engagement and sales process
- Act as a key liaison between sales, operations, product, and marketing to align enablement priorities and ensure consistent messaging
- Partner with product marketing to ensure alignment on go-to-market messaging, new product launches, and value propositions
- Engage with account management teams to capture the best practices and customer insights to inform enablement materials
- Attend team meetings to learn and support ongoing needs
